CLARKSVILLE, TN (CLARKSVILLE NOW) – This weekend boogie down at sundown with live Motown music, celebrate local heritage, explore all things odd and curious, and watch drag racing thrills all while enjoying the season of Summer.

Downtown @ Sundown: Head out to Downtown Commons, 215 Legion St. on Friday, June 7 at 7 p.m. to sing and dance to all your favorite Motown music live with Motor City

Clarksville Oddities and Curiosities Market: Explore a diverse collection of unusual items from local vendors, including taxidermy, medical artifacts, creepy art, and mystical oddities. The event begins on Sunday, June 9 from 11-7 p.m. at the Wilma Rudolph Event Center, 8 Champions Way. It is free and open to the public.

Summer Fest at Clarksville Speedway: A car show plus drag racing, drifting and donut pit with live music and food vendors. The fun begins on Sunday, June 9 at 10 a.m. to 9 p.m. at the Clarksville Speedway, 1600 Needmore Road. $20 admission, 5 and younger free. Additional pricing for contests.

Montgomery County Heritage Day: Reenactors will portray several people from the county’s past including Civil War soldiers, civilians, and spies. The day begins on Friday, June 7 at 10 a.m. at 4711 Weakley Road. $14 per adult, $8 per child ages 3-12, children under 3 free with a paying adult.
